Pakistan Says Afghan Drones Intercepted in Multiple Areas
According to a statement from Inter-Services Public Relations, the media division of the Pakistan Army, the "Afghan Taliban" deployed several primitive drones on Friday “to harass the people of Pakistan.” The statement added that security forces neutralized the drones using both soft-kill and hard-kill tactics before they could hit their designated objectives.
The military noted that the two wounded children were located in the southwestern city of Quetta in Balochistan province. Another civilian sustained injuries in Kohat district in the northwestern province of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, while one more person was hurt in the garrison town of Rawalpindi, which lies next to the national capital, Islamabad.
“These attacks were aimed at inducing fear among the public and remind us of the terrorist mindset that drives the Afghan Taliban. On one hand, the Afghan Taliban project victimhood to garner global sympathy, while on the other hand they actively target civilians through their terrorist proxies and drones,” the military said.
Authorities in Islamabad cautioned that the “Ghazab-lil-Haq” operation will persist until the Afghan Taliban resolve Pakistan’s primary security concerns.
So far, officials in Kabul have not issued any response to the Pakistani announcement.
The statement followed remarks from the Afghan Defense Ministry on Friday claiming it had responded to Pakistani airstrikes by striking “strategic military centers and facilities” belonging to the Pakistani army in the Kohat region of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a.
